How to fill out the policy for granting waivers:

01
Begin by clearly defining the purpose of the policy. Specify the circumstances in which waivers may be granted and outline the criteria that applicants must meet.
02
Identify the key stakeholders involved in the waiver granting process. This may include department heads, legal advisors, and decision-makers. Clearly define their roles and responsibilities within the policy.
03
Determine the application process for individuals seeking waivers. Specify the documents and information required for submission and set deadlines for application review.
04
Establish a review committee or panel responsible for assessing waiver applications. Define the composition of the committee and outline the decision-making process.
05
Create a standardized evaluation criteria that will be used to assess each application. This may include factors such as eligibility, justification, potential impact, and compliance with relevant regulations or policies.
06
Develop a clear and transparent decision-making process for the waiver granting. Specify the timeline for reviewing applications, communicating decisions to applicants, and notifying relevant parties.
07
Include provisions for an appeal process in case an application is denied. Outline the steps for appealing a decision and the timeframe within which individuals can submit an appeal.
08
Provide guidelines on how to document and maintain records related to waiver applications and decisions. Ensure that all records are kept confidential and comply with relevant data protection regulations.

Who needs a policy for granting waivers?

01
Organizations or institutions that have specific requirements and regulations in place may need a policy for granting waivers. This can include educational institutions, government agencies, healthcare providers, or professional associations.
02
Departments or divisions within an organization that have the authority to grant waivers to certain individuals or entities may require a policy to ensure consistent and fair decision-making.
03
Individuals who are responsible for evaluating waiver requests and making decisions will need to follow a written policy to maintain transparency and accountability in the process.
